The 2025 Kamchatka Earthquake and Tsunami: Cascading Impacts and Risks to Japan
ABSTRACT On July 29th, 2025, a large earthquake (Mw 8.8) occurred near the Kamchatka Peninsula. This event caused a tsunami that reached Japan's Pacific coast, even though the source was far away. In this study, we analyze the characteristics of earthquakes and tsunamis and discuss how they relate to the recurrence possibility and risk in Japan.

Mixing Behavior of Natural Gas and Hydrogen in a High‐Efficiency Vane (HEV) Static Mixer
Static mixers play a crucial role in the safe transport of hydrogen‐blended natural gas. Computational fluid dynamics (CFD) was employed to investigate the effects of structural parameters of the HEV static mixer on the mixing behavior and homogeneity of natural gas and hydrogen. The modeling approach was well validated against experimental data.

Three flat‐plate collectors with spiral and square coiled riser tubes were tested and it was found that the spiral type provides the best results with a thermal efficiency of 66.98% for a mass flow rate of 0.4 kg/min. Riser tube geometry is a key factor in optimizing flat‐plate collector output.

Renewable Energies in Kazakhstan: Current Status, Potential, Challenges, and Opportunities
Kazakhstan has strong renewable energy potential, with wind as the leading resource and solar and other sources offering additional opportunities. Key challenges include limited infrastructure, investment needs, and grid‐related technical issues.
